Are HEPA Filters Required in Operating Rooms?

In the world of healthcare, maintaining a sterile environment is paramount, especially in operating rooms where surgical procedures are performed. One of the key components in achieving this is the use of High-Efficiency Particulate Air (HEPA) filters. The question that often arises is whether HEPA filters are required in operating rooms. This article delves into the importance of HEPA filters in these critical spaces and the reasons behind their necessity.

Operating rooms are designed to minimize the risk of infection during surgical procedures. HEPA filters play a crucial role in this process by removing airborne particles, including bacteria, viruses, and other contaminants, from the air. These filters have a minimum efficiency of 99.97% at capturing particles as small as 0.3 micrometers, which is essential in preventing the spread of harmful microorganisms.

The Role of HEPA Filters in Controlling Infection

Controlling infection in operating rooms is a top priority, as surgical site infections can lead to prolonged hospital stays, increased healthcare costs, and even death in some cases. HEPA filters help in maintaining a clean and sterile environment by trapping particles that could otherwise settle on surgical instruments, patient bedding, and other surfaces. This reduces the risk of cross-contamination and minimizes the chances of infection during surgery.

Moreover, HEPA filters contribute to the overall air quality in operating rooms. They remove dust, pollen, and other allergens from the air, making the environment more comfortable for both patients and healthcare professionals. This is particularly important for patients with compromised immune systems or allergies, as it reduces the risk of exacerbating their conditions.

Regulatory Standards and Guidelines

The use of HEPA filters in operating rooms is not just a matter of best practices; it is also governed by regulatory standards and guidelines. Organizations such as the Centers for Medicare & Medicaid Services (CMS) and the Joint Commission require healthcare facilities to meet specific criteria for maintaining a sterile environment. This includes the use of HEPA filters to ensure air quality and reduce the risk of infection.

Furthermore, professional associations like the Association of periOperative Registered Nurses (AORN) provide guidelines on best practices for infection control in operating rooms. These guidelines often recommend the use of HEPA filters as an essential component of maintaining a sterile environment.
